    Technical Specification Powered Head/ Model Number VX63 accessory release clip Name Vax Cordless Blade Pet Pro Battery voltage 28.8V Powered Head Run time Up to 45 minutes* Charge time 4 hours Brushbar Weight 3.0 kg...
  • Page 6 Getting started Getting started Fixing the wall bracket PLEASE READ ‘LET’S TALK SAFETY’ BEFORE USE CAUTION: The battery used in this device may present a risk of fire or chemical burn if mistreated. Do not disassemble or heat above manufacturer’s maximum temperature limit (60°C/140°F) or incinerate. Use of another battery may present a risk of fire or explosion.
  • Page 7 Getting started Using your machine Charging the battery CAUTION: For use on delicate hard floors, the brushbar must be turned off to enable slow suction. To prevent any damage being sustained test on an inconspicuous area of the flooring. WARNING: Do not use the vacuum cleaner when the machine is plugged in and charging. NOTE: Once the battery is fully depleted the vacuum will still turn on for a few seconds.
